Daisy Belle Guess

Brief Life History of Daisy Belle

When Daisy Belle Guess was born on 21 February 1876, in Ely, Linn, Iowa, United States, her father, Josiah H Guess, was 43 and her mother, Margaret Ann Gilmore, was 32. She married Jesse Woodward Glass on 2 May 1900, in Cedar Rapids, Linn, Iowa, United States. They were the parents of at least 4 sons and 4 daughters. She lived in Corwin Township, Ida, Iowa, United States in 1920 and Holstein, Ida, Iowa, United States in 1925. She died on 4 March 1957, in Ida Grove, Ida, Iowa, United States, at the age of 81, and was buried in Ida Grove, Ida, Iowa, United States.

Name Meaning

English (southern): probably a variant of Guest with loss of final -t.

South German (Güss): see Guss .

German: variant of Geis .

Dictionary of American Family Names © Patrick Hanks 2003, 2006.
